Loading episode...

S1:E2 - Mayhem on the Dudesons Ranch

Mayhem on the Dudesons Ranch

S1:E2
2006 IMDb

The Dudesons try out new car stunts. They join up with Bam Margera in "The Human Dart Board" and they perform a wake up call with a metal baseball bat.

Episodes